Group Singing: The Heart of Resistance Movements (Ben Grosscup, Peoples Music Network)
Group Singing: The Heart of Resistance Movements How can musically-inspired activists put song back at the center of protest? Group singing at strikes and demonstrations can: 1) Generate courage and collective power; 2) Intimidate political adversaries; 3) Bring joy to movement events; and 4) Convey key ideas in memorable ways.
